Output 58f3cb4638ad37785cd1357a37e14123dacb2a300c92c0b15f565934841564a8:0

value
3986461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567401e2731403d8c7100b94f010d4cbccde5572 OP_EQUAL
address
MFnHKG4Dpm97AAveA5mJHLC4mWWrp3UdF8
transaction
58f3cb4638ad37785cd1357a37e14123dacb2a300c92c0b15f565934841564a8
spent
true